Product details

The Infineon BTS500551TMB is a single-channel high-side power switch in the PROFET family. Its typical on-resistance of 4.4 mOhm sets the conduction loss floor. The 55 A maximum output current rating covers heavy loads like motors, solenoids, and pre-charge circuits.

The load voltage range spans 5 V to 34 V. The switch does not require a Vcc supply — it self-powers from the load pin, simplifying the BOM by eliminating a separate bias rail. Fault protection includes fixed current limiting, open load detection, over-temperature shutdown, over-voltage clamp, short-circuit protection, and under-voltage lockout.

Package and mounting — TO-220-7 formed leads

The BTS500551TMB comes in a TO-220-7 package with formed leads (P-TO220-7-11), a through-hole footprint that suits power-dissipation designs requiring a heatsink. The 7-lead layout is specific to this PROFET family — verify the hole pattern against the board layout before committing.

Frequently asked questions

What is the Rds(on) of BTS500551TMB?

The typical on-resistance is 4.4 mOhm. This value is specified at 25°C junction; actual Rds(on) increases with temperature per the normalised curve in the datasheet, so derate the continuous current for high-temperature operation.

Does BTS500551TMB have overcurrent protection?

Yes, it includes fixed current limiting, short-circuit protection, and over-temperature shutdown. The protection suite also covers open load detection, over-voltage clamping, and under-voltage lockout.
